CVE-2022-4468: WP Recipe Maker < 8.6.1 - Contributor+ Stored XSS
The WP Recipe Maker WordPress plugin before 8.6.1 does not validate and escape some of its shortcode attributes before outputting them back in the page, which could allow users with a role as low as contributor to perform Stored Cross-Site Scripting attacks which could be used against high privilege users such as admin.

What is the severity of CVE-2022-4468?
The severity of CVE-2022-4468 is medium with a CVSS score of 5.4.

What software versions are affected by CVE-2022-4468?
WP Recipe Maker plugin versions up to and excluding 8.6.1 are affected by CVE-2022-4468.
Is there a fix available for CVE-2022-4468?
Yes, updating the WP Recipe Maker plugin to version 8.6.1 or higher will fix the vulnerability.
